<generator>Blogsmith http://www.blogsmith.com/</generator><item><title><![CDATA[Temple Run 2 travels to the land of Oz]]></title><link>http://www.joystiq.com/2013/03/05/temple-run-2-travels-to-the-land-of-oz/</link><guid isPermaLink="true">http://www.joystiq.com/2013/03/05/temple-run-2-travels-to-the-land-of-oz/</guid><comments>http://www.joystiq.com/2013/03/05/temple-run-2-travels-to-the-land-of-oz/#comments</comments><description><![CDATA[<div style="text-align: center;"> <a class="hidden" href="http://www.joystiq.com/2013/03/05/temple-run-2-travels-to-the-land-of-oz/"><img alt="Temple Run gets another film variation, this time Oz" class="hidden" data-src-height="350" data-src-width="530" src="http://www.blogcdn.com/www.joystiq.com/media/2013/03/templerunoz530.jpg" /></a></div><center> <iframe allowfullscreen="" frameborder="0" height="298" src="http://www.youtube.com/embed/AxUY3ucvwcQ?rel=0&amp;wmode=opaque" width="530"></iframe></center><br />Disney and Imangi Studios are collaborating again with <em>Temple Run: Oz</em>, a mishmash of <em>Temple Run 2</em> and the coming film <em>Oz the Great and Powerful</em>. The two previously played nice on <em>Temple Run: Brave</em>.<br /><br />If you've played <em>Temple Run 2</em> - and it would appear <a href="http://www.joystiq.com/2013/01/31/temple-run-2-sprints-and-slides-past-50-million-downloads/">at least 50 million of you have</a> - this latest version has the same running, jumping and sliding gameplay, but now with a yellow brick road.<br /><br />The gameplay isn't just confined to the wizard's inexhaustible stamina; there are sections where players will be tasked with guiding a hot-air balloon. "They don't have me directing <em>World of Warcraft</em> anymore," he told the site. "Because when I took the <em>Oz</em> job, they had to move on to another director. They had to start making it."<br /><br />Given that <em>Oz: The Great and Powerful</em> is due out next March, it stands to reason that Raimi's been off the WoW film for some time - and that the film may actually be in production. Blizzard has yet to comment publicly on the news, or to say who is replacing Raimi, but we've reached out for more info.<br /><br />News arose that Raimi was out <a href="http://www.joystiq.com/2010/10/07/world-of-warcraft-movie-on-ice-as-raimi-commits-to-disney-oz/">as early as October 2010</a>, when Deadline reported that Raimi was out (due to his <em>Oz</em> gig) and the <em>WoW</em> film was on hold.
